What are the key skills and qualifications needed to thrive in the atmosphere models position, and why are they important?

To thrive as an Atmosphere Modeler, you need a strong background in atmospheric sciences, meteorology, or a related field, typically complemented by experience in numerical modeling and data analysis. Proficiency with tools such as MATLAB, Python, Fortran, and specialized atmospheric modeling software like WRF or HYSPLIT, along with relevant certifications, is often required. Critical thinking, attention to detail, and strong communication skills are important for interpreting results and collaborating with multidisciplinary teams. These competencies are crucial for generating accurate atmospheric predictions and contributing to research or policy decisions.

What is an atmosphere model?

An Atmosphere Models job involves developing, testing, and improving computational models that simulate atmospheric processes like weather patterns, climate change, and air quality. Professionals in this field use mathematical equations and data analysis to predict atmospheric behavior and support research in meteorology, environmental science, and aviation. They often work with government agencies, research institutions, or private companies to enhance forecasting accuracy and understand climate dynamics. Strong skills in programming, physics, and data modeling are essential for success in this role.

What does a typical workday look like for an atmosphere modeler, and with whom do they usually collaborate?

As an Atmosphere Modeler, your workday typically involves developing, running, and analyzing computer simulations that predict atmospheric conditions, as well as processing large sets of environmental data. You will frequently collaborate with meteorologists, climate scientists, software engineers, and sometimes government or industry stakeholders to refine models and interpret results. Much of your work is computer-based, but you may also participate in meetings to discuss findings or plan research initiatives. This collaborative and analytical environment offers variety and intellectual challenge, while also providing opportunities for professional growth as you contribute to impactful environmental projects.
